Hi, Folks. Long-time SONAR user; noob Notion user. Rather than exhaustively reciting everything I've tried, and the obstacles I've encountered, I'll just ask if someone can give me a brief outline in broad strokes of how best to do this:

Suppose I have a nicely quantized solo piano performance saved as a Type 1 MIDI file with the right-hand part on track 1, and the left-hand part on track 2. How can I most quickly and easily get this imported to Notion as a single grand staff with the two parts in their respective clefs?

Sorry I didn't get back to you sooner....

Best way to do this is to import each hand or part individually to a treble and a bass clef respectively. Then simply copy and paste the individual parts to the corresponding staff on the Grand Staff.
